Transaction 05e4a31304dd64f40c8abcef37b7a45b5caf98a0ee17afdc120c22db2c500a2d

1 Input
2 Outputs
  • 05e4a31304dd64f40c8abcef37b7a45b5caf98a0ee17afdc120c22db2c500a2d:0
  • value  60703500
    address  31sEpL5anbkGJE8y1x4oKLcWFDkifcUqeq
  • 05e4a31304dd64f40c8abcef37b7a45b5caf98a0ee17afdc120c22db2c500a2d:1
  • value  512891311
    address  38xpbykYgqqAzqkWkpAdBqRakVztbApcbX